Course Curriculum Overview

5

The curriculum is pretty stuff and is the same throughout the country as created by the Medical Council of India ( MCI ). It's a 5 and half year duration course with 4 and half year of academics and 1 year of internship. 3 internals and 1 professional ( final ) exams are conducted every year.

Placement Experience

5

100% placement is guaranteed anywhere in India and also in abroad after appearing for the specific exams of those countries. College provides internship of 1 year in the JSS hospital where there are plenty of patients. The current stipend provided is 12,000 Rs.

Fee Structure And Facilities

The fees structure of 2016-2017 was better more feasible which was 7,14,750 Rs but the present fees is quite expensive which is around 16 lakhs per year. The fees has almost doubled from 2016-2017 to 2017-2018.

Fees and Financial Aid

Education loans are available from banks like State Bank of India. But the maximum loan is limited to 10,00,000 Rs. Loan application has to be submitted to the bank where the student would be asked to submit a fee structure provided by the college.

Admission

Selection was based on NEET ranks and marks that were sent to the college a month before the admission since it's a deemed college. 3 rounds of counselings were done and I got admission in the 1st round under the merit seats.

Faculty

4.5

Efficient faculty who are there to help out throughout the whole course providing help in acedmic, practical and emotional ways. There is a system of mentorship provided in the first and second initial years where a group of 3-4 students are alloted to a particular professor who keeps a check on the students and provide them special care.
